Why has the worship of performing Qiyam al-Layl and reciting long surahs during Witr become difficult or impossible in our time, and did Allah single out only the Companions and Prophets for it?
What you mentioned about the absence of those who perform acts of worship like Qiyam al-Layl (night prayer) is an exaggeration. Goodness remains in the Ummah (Muslim community) and such people exist in every era. You will be rewarded for the night prayers you perform, and your consistency in this amount is good; you can gradually increase it. The best night prayer is that of David (peace be upon him): he would sleep half the night, pray for a third of it, and sleep for a sixth. Achieving aspirations requires diligent effort and perseverance. You should also supplicate and read the biographies of prominent and noble figures.
